Thermal Imaging Red-tailed Phascogales at Tutanning Nature Reserve

Wiilman Country Red-tailed Phascogales are a miniscule dasyurid now restricted to remnant bushland in the West Australian Wheatbelt. The habitat in which it is found is She-oak woodland associated with a mixture of Wandoo and/or Powderbark.
